Hello World
hello world there is purpose in your indiscretions your uncertainties and calm reflections i've gazed upon you awash in moonbeams a prism of undiscovered dreams you teach me patience and longing a joy i could never express and without it fierce loneliness when i lose myself i need only look around me your lush landscape the vestiges of past inhabitants remnants of people who lived, breathed, and loved you
